| Frequency Range Class | 26.5 GHz - 40 GHz (Continuous Ka-Band Spectral Optimization) |
| Antenna Radiator Style | Standard Gain Horn |
| Nominal Gain Baseline | 25 dBi |
| V.S.W.R Profile (Typical) | 1.25 : 1 (Precision Minimal Reflection Performance) |
| Maximum Input Power | 250 Watts (CW Continuous Wave Limit) |
| -3dB Beamwidth (H-Plane / E-Plane) | 10° / 9° (Narrow Focused Resolution Profile) |
| Nominal System Impedance | 50 Ohms |
| Physical Dimensions (W x H x L) | 60 x 75.5 x 194 mm |
| Antenna Net Weight Profile | 105 g (Precision Aluminum Alloy Structural Build) |
| Waveguide Interface Layout | EIA WR-28 / Standard UBR (UG-599U Compatible) Flange face |
| Connector Interface Type | Precision Stainless Steel 2.92mm-Female (K Connector) |
| Manufacturing Origin | Taiwan Design & Made in Taiwan (FT-RF Professional Grade) |
